Your Role: Supply Chain Analyst
This role is critical for the successful execution of intercompany operations, managing everything from arranging domestic and international shipments and ensuring EX/IM compliance, to performing replenishment transactions.
It's also responsible for monitoring affiliate inventory levels and proactively providing recommendations to maintain healthy stock.
Success in this position requires strong communication skills, attention to detail, the ability to prioritize, and exposure to logistics and manufacturing planning at Elanco, all within a fast-paced environment.
Your Responsibilities:
* Exceptional Customer Service & Logistics Coordination: Provide top-tier customer service for all intercompany shipments, managing documentation, freight, and resolving issues like damage or delays, with special attention to complex export orders.
* Proactive Inventory Monitoring & Supply Optimization: Regularly review affiliate inventory levels, identify changing requirements, and offer recommendations and risk strategies to maintain healthy stock and efficient demand management.
* SAP Purchase Order Management & Communication: Accurately create and modify purchase orders in SAP, ensuring timely communication of all changes in product availability or delivery timing to key stakeholders.
* Cross-functional Collaboration & New Product Support: Build strong relationships across departments (e.g., Manufacturing, Regulatory) and assist in coordinating new product launches to ensure alignment and supply availability.
* Process Improvement & Project Management: Manage ICOS team projects, ensure proper documentation and training, and support the resolution of supply issues and shipping prioritization to minimize market impacts.
